My Writing World
What I feel when I write
Is a piece of my own delight.
My feelings in thoughts,
My words on paper,
The dreams I sought,
Like a ballet’s caper.
If in happiness or in sorrow,
In light of today,
Or dreams of tomorrow.
I feel what I write
And write what I feel
With words so unfurled
I find such comfort in
My writing world.
By Malissa (Friend) Stidham
